“Let’s Talk Together (about Migration)”

 

SIMI (Association for Integration and Migration/Sdružení pro integraci a migraci), Czech Republic

Launched in 2018

 

The “Let´s Talk Together (about Migration)” project is a part of work done by the Association for Integration and Migration (Sdružení pro integraci a migraci, or SIMI) around inclusion in the schools of Prague and Central Bohemia.

 

The first community event, organised by SIMI in co-operation with the Prague Humanities Gymnasium, took place at the end of the school year, one in which pupils of Prague schools had the opportunity to meet and talk with migrants and SIMI workers on the topic of migration and refugees. The event featured migrants from countries such as Mongolia, the Democratic Republic of the Congo, Ukraine, or Mexico, who prepared workshops on cultures and points of interest about their countries.

 

SIMI has a long history of educating the public on migration and refugees and creating opportunities for joint encounters and understanding between migrants and Czech society. It aims to raise awareness among students of all ages and their teachers about migration and to involve them in the process of local integration, in direct contact with migrants. SIMI also organises teacher trainings on migration and integration issues.

 “We strive convey the topic of refugees and migration to students and to explain some basic terms, as well as to use situational examples to convey the problems that foreigners have to face in our country. Working with young people is especially important since developing the formation of positive approach to strangers contributes to general elimination of stereotypes and biases in the majority of our society.
